FSR performance: FPS with AI upscaling

Upscaling renders NBA 2K26 at a lower internal resolution and reconstructs the image, so you trade a little sharpness for extra frames. These are the estimated figures for the RX 7800 XT with FSR enabled, starting from its native Ultra FPS.

ResolutionNativeFSR QualityFSR Performance+ Frame generation
1080p148185215315
1440p121163200277
4K6391117155

Frame generation inserts intermediate frames: it raises the smoothness you see on screen, but it does not reduce input latency, so use it selectively in competitive games.

About ray tracing: every figure on this page is with ray tracing off. The RX 7800 XT does have dedicated hardware for it, so you can turn it on in games that implement it. The FPS cost swings widely depending on how much ray tracing each title uses, and FSR is exactly what people lean on to pay for it.

Estimated figures. The real gain varies by game and by the version of the technology.

Frequently asked questions about NBA 2K26 on the RX 7800 XT

How many FPS does the RX 7800 XT get in NBA 2K26 at 1080p?
The RX 7800 XT averages 148 FPS in NBA 2K26 at 1080p on Ultra settings. Dropping to High takes it to around 193 FPS, and Low reaches roughly 326 FPS.
What about 1440p and 4K?
On Ultra, the RX 7800 XT manages around 121 FPS at 1440p and around 63 FPS at 4K. Those are native figures: switching on AI upscaling lifts both considerably.
Can the RX 7800 XT run NBA 2K26 at 60 FPS?
Yes. On Ultra settings the RX 7800 XT averages above 60 FPS in NBA 2K26 at 1080p, 1440p, 4K. At higher resolutions you can claw back smoothness by lowering the preset or turning on upscaling.
Do these NBA 2K26 figures include upscaling or ray tracing?
No. Every FPS figure on this page is native, with no DLSS, FSR or XeSS, and with ray tracing off. The RX 7800 XT can do both: upscaling pushes the frame rate up, ray tracing pulls it down.
How many FPS do I gain by turning on FSR in NBA 2K26?
At 4K, FSR on Quality mode takes the RX 7800 XT from around 63 native FPS to an estimated 91 FPS. Performance mode goes higher still, at the cost of some image sharpness.
What processor do I need to pair with the RX 7800 XT?
The figures on this page assume a Intel Core i5-13400, a mid-range processor that does not bottleneck the card. What matters with the RX 7800 XT is that the CPU is not far below it: past that class, moving up a processor barely changes FPS at higher resolutions.
